Effect of Spacing on the Form Factor of Pinus taeda L.

ABSTRACT
This study aimed to evaluate the effect of spacing on shape stem Pinus taeda L. at nine years old.The experiment with 9 different spacings covering areas 1 16 m² was installed in country Irati, Paraná.The data from treatments were grouped into classes diameter.The volume obtained by method Smalian, using trees represent each treatment diameter classes, totaling 81 trees.The form factor calculated express stems and completely randomized design used verify influence trunk.It observed denser that tends be larger, ie, they have more cylindrical trunks compared less dense spacing.The maximum value found (0,645) lowest one 10,5 (0,397), corresponded a difference 38,54%.The around 7,5 per tree seemed appropriate reduce trunk
